But even unto this day, when
Moses is read, the vail is upon their heart. Nevertheless when it shall turn to
the Lord, the veil shall be taken away. Now the Lord is that Spirit: and where
the Spirit of the Lord is, there is liberty (2 Corinthians 3:15-17).
When men don’t understand the Word of God, it’s because there’s a veil
covering their hearts. It’s like what happened with the Law of Moses, in the
Old Testament: the children of Israel couldn’t see the glory beyond the veil.
Our opening verse tells us that even until this day, when "Moses,"
that is, "the Law," is read, that veil is still present; it’s only
taken away in Christ. In other words, when you received salvation in accordance
with Romans 10:9, the Lordship of Jesus destroyed the power of darkness over
your life and took away the veil from your heart.
At the New Birth, you were catapulted into the Kingdom of Light; the
Kingdom of God’s dear Son. Colossians 1:12-13 says, "Giving thanks unto
the Father, which hath made us meet to be partakers of the inheritance of the
saints in light: Who hath delivered us from the power of darkness, and hath
translated us into the kingdom of his dear Son."
The Holy Spirit accomplished this in your life when He baptized you
into Christ: "For by one Spirit are we all baptized into one body…"
(1 Corinthians 12:13); that body is Christ. Christ is "Light"; so
upon the New Birth, the Holy Spirit baptized you into the "Light,"
and you became awakened to the Fatherhood of God. Thus was the veil removed
from your heart to walk in the light of God, and understand spiritual
realities.
